  总会有些书让人废寝忘食。今天小编就为大家介绍9本让读者们爱不释手的外国小说。快来看看有没有你喜欢的小说吧~

  There are books which captivate us so much that we don’t even want to spend time sleeping and eating.Bright Side publishes for you a list of such novels — they’re simply unputdownable!

  总会有些书让我们读到废寝忘食。Bright Side网站罗列了9部让读者们爱不释手的小说。

  

  01

  George R. R. Martin — ’A Song of Ice and Fire: A Game of Thrones’

  乔治·R·R·马丁——《冰与火之歌:权力的游戏》

  

  This novel needs no introduction. All of us have watched the TV series of the same name, or we have at least heard something about it. The events of the book take place on the continent of Westeros, where the characters are involved in a struggle for the throne. Royal intrigues, conspiracies, and war haunt the reader throughout the novel.

  这部小说无需过多介绍。想必所有人都看过同名电视连续剧,最不济也对此书有所耳闻。该书的故事发生在维斯特洛大陆上,书里的角色在这里陷入了权力的纷争。在阅读小说过程中,读者能读到到皇权争夺,阴谋诡计和战争。

  02

  Gillian Flynn — ’Gone Girl’

  吉莉安·弗琳——《消失的爱人》

  

  A married couple decides to celebrate their wedding anniversary, but suddenly one of the heroes of the occasion disappears. There are signs of a struggle and blood in the house. All the evidence points to the husband, but is he really guilty of his wife’s disappearance? The book makes us wonder how well we really know our soul mates.

  一对夫妻打算庆祝他们的结婚纪念日,但是妻子却突然意外消失了。屋里有斗争迹象和流血的痕迹。一切线索都表明是丈夫杀了妻子,但事实确实如此吗?这本书让我们不禁思考是否真正了解自己的精神伴侣。

  03

  Kazuo Ishiguro — ’Never Let Me Go’

  石黑一雄——《别让我走》

  

  A dystopian novel with such a realistic plot that it chills to the bone. The alternative Britain of the late 20th century. There’s a private boarding school where the children study and put on school plays. But over time the pupils learn that their fate is organ donation and that they were created in order to save the terminally ill.

  这是一部反乌托邦小说,但是书中的现实主义情节令读者毛骨悚然。故事发生在20世纪末另类的英国,孩子们在一所私立寄宿学校里学习和玩耍。但不久之后学生们发现自己的真实身份是克隆人,他们的存在是为了器官捐献,而他们存活的意义是挽救患绝症的人类。(小译强烈推荐这本书,至今还记得第一次读这本书时的那种无力感)

  04

  Markus Zusak — ’The Book Thief’

  马克斯·苏萨克——《偷书贼》

  

  January 1939, Germany. The tragic events in the country force a nine-year-old Liesel Meminger and her family to leave their home. On the road, her younger brother has to face an unwanted guest — death, which notices Liesel for the first time. The amazing story of a little girl who went through a lot, despite her young age.

  这个悲惨的故事发生在1939年1月的德国。(因为战争,)9岁的小女孩莉赛尔和她的家人被迫从所居住的城市离开,但她弟弟不幸死在了路上。在弟弟葬礼之后,莉赛尔得到了改变她人生的第一本书。小说里的女孩虽然年纪很小,但她却经历颇丰。

  05

  Ian McEwan — ’Atonement’

  伊恩·麦克尤恩——《赎罪》

  

  A profound and lyrical novel about love and treachery, about art and the mistakes for which someone has to pay for — for the rest of their life. A teenage girl writes 'a chronicle of lost time,' childishly rethinking the events of adulthood. The book was filmed, and the film was presented at the Venice Film Festival, winning 2 Golden Globe Awards.

  这部小说讲述了爱和背叛,围绕着艺术和用余生赎罪的故事展开。这是一部具有深远意义的抒情小说。它记录了一名青春期少女的‘迷失时期’,她曾幼稚地以为自己可以以成年人的思维成熟地思考问题。改编自此书的同名电影曾在威尼斯国际电影节上展映,并曾夺得两项金球奖。

  06

  Carlos Ruiz Zafón — 'The Shadow of the Wind'

  卡洛斯·鲁伊斯·萨丰——《风之影》

  

  The novel takes place in 1945 in Barcelona, where the main character, a ten-year-old boy, finds a mysterious book that changes his life. For 20 years he tries to unravel the mysteries related to this book, meeting mysterious strangers on his way.

  这部小说发生在1945年的巴塞罗那。小说的主人公是一名十岁的男孩,他找到了一本足以改变他一生的神秘书籍。之后的20年他一直在试图解开书中的秘密,也因此不断地遇到神秘的陌生人。

  07

  David Mitchell — ’Cloud Atlas’

  大卫·米切尔——《云图》

  

  This is a bright and exciting novel, whose plot develops from the middle of the 19th century to a distant post-apocalyptic future. There are 6 stories, and there’s a place for treachery and murder, love and devotion. Everyone will understand this book in his or her own way — it’s like a mosaic, and each of us can make it our own.

  这是一部简洁但却激动人心的小说,它的时间跨度从十九世纪中叶一直到后末日未来。小说涵盖6个故事,讲述了背叛和谋杀,爱情和牺牲。每个人会从自己的角度理解这本书,就像不同的人对马赛克会有不同的认识。

  08

  Neil Gaiman — ’American Gods’

  尼尔·盖曼——《美国众神》

  

  One of the author’s most famous works. This is a novel about the gods, brought to America by different people all around the world — revered, then forgotten — and about the thing that leaves no man indifferent: the search for a father, a homeland, a beloved woman... and about death — symbolic and real.

  该书是作者尼尔·盖曼最有名的作品之一。这是一部关于众神的小说,人们从世界各地汇聚美国,随之带来了他们所尊敬信奉的神灵,但之后人们便将这些神灵遗忘。在小说中,为了寻找一位父亲,一个故乡,一位深爱的女人…以及面对死亡,人们不再像之前般冷漠。这部小说很真实,而且具有象征意义。

  09

  Khaled Hosseini — ’The Kite Runner’

  卡勒德·胡赛尼——《追风筝的人》

  

  A profound novel about the friendship and loyalty of two boys — Amir and Hassan. One of them belongs to the local aristocracy, and the other to a despised minority. Their stories unfold against the backdrop of the Kabul idyll, which is soon replaced by terrible storms. Each of the boys has his own destiny, but their bond is still as strong as in their childhood.

  这是一部讲述阿米尔和哈桑这两个男孩之间友情和忠诚的小说,意义深远。阿米尔出生于当地一个贵族家庭,而哈桑出身卑微,是阿米尔家仆人的儿子。故事以喀布尔的田园生活为背景展开,但很快就陷入恐怖的风暴。小说中每个男孩都有自己的归宿,但是他们之间的联系却还同儿时一样紧密。
